About this Event
We are all familiar with the cooling properties of a fan. But for some reason most of us don't carry one during the hot months, instead using random magazines and other items when we need to cool off. But there was a time when a fan was not just a practical necessity, but was also a fashion statement and means of communicating silent messages.
This workshop begins with a presentation by Colleen Pappas on the history and language of the fan in the 19th century. This will be followed by a workshop with Nancy Gaines where you will make and decorate your own fan.
Limit of 10 participants. $40 per person.
